Introduction

CLASP stands for Command-Line Argument Sorting and Parsing. The first CLASP library was a C library with a C++ wrapper. There have been several implementations in other languages. CLASP.Python is the Python version.

Installation & usage

Install via pip or pip3, as in:

$ pip3 install pyclasp

Use via import:

import pyclasp

or, as we prefer,

import pyclasp as clasp
